Output d3686462988e77dbef6fb2751a53827fe8d92aa36bbae741445ec9ca8597e526:19

value
41390910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93fae7f2e3ff24ee949426031d17f655704dc21c OP_EQUAL
address
MMPc8tQvEAxqzWq4ArwYRVd8D4zPvnqoF9
transaction
d3686462988e77dbef6fb2751a53827fe8d92aa36bbae741445ec9ca8597e526
spent
true